As a mature project with no A-B testing or usage information, it's very hard to evaluate the success or even usage of browsers and plugins... or even numbers around QL users themselves (though see below)

Some carefully thought-out anonymous usage metrics would help here. They should be enabled / disabled by user preferences. Obviously there are considerations of formats, storage, protocols, etc, but it's doable and should help the longer term development of Quod Libet.
